Saint Lucia keeps one clock all year: Atlantic Standard Time (Castries), UTC-4. Clocks do not change for daylight saving time.

Typical times at each zone's reference point, in that zone's local clock. Year-to-year drift is under a couple of minutes; dates near a daylight saving change can shift the clock reading by an hour.
| Time of year | Sunrise | Sunset | Day length |
|---|---|---|---|
| March equinox (about Mar 20) | 06:07 | 18:14 | 12Β h 07Β m |
| June solstice (about Jun 21) | 05:37 | 18:34 | 12Β h 57Β m |
| September equinox (about Sep 22) | 05:53 | 18:00 | 12Β h 07Β m |
| December solstice (about Dec 21) | 06:23 | 17:41 | 11Β h 18Β m |
